Key 1: Recognizing When Your Roof Needs Help

Your roof will show signs of wear before a small issue becomes a major disaster. Spotting these early signals can save you thousands. Look for:

  • Leaks and Water Stains: The most obvious red flag. A small drip on your ceiling can quickly lead to structural damage and mold. Address it immediately.
  • Ice Dams: A common Kingston winter problem where melted snow refreezes at the eaves, forcing water under shingles. This is often caused by poor attic insulation and ventilation.
  • Missing or Damaged Shingles: Check your yard for shingles after a windstorm. Bare patches on your roof leave the underlayment exposed and vulnerable.
  • Curling or Buckling Shingles: Shingles that are no longer flat can’t shed water properly, accelerating wear on the entire system.
  • Granules in Gutters: These sand-like particles protect your asphalt shingles. If your gutters are full of them, your shingles are nearing the end of their life.
  • A Sagging Roofline: This indicates a serious structural problem that needs immediate professional assessment. Do not delay.
  • Moss and Algae: This growth traps moisture against your shingles, leading to rot and deterioration.

Key 2: Choosing the Right Materials for Kingston’s Climate

For Roofing Kingston MA, material choice is about armoring your home against New England weather. Here are the top contenders:

  • Asphalt Shingles: The most popular choice, offering a great balance of affordability, versatility, and durability. Modern architectural shingles are thick, handle strong winds well, and come in many styles.
  • Metal Roofing: A long-term investment that can last 50+ years. Metal is excellent at shedding snow and ice, making it ideal for Kingston winters. It’s fire-resistant, rot-proof, and comes in various modern styles.
  • Slate Roofing: The ultimate in longevity and beauty, a slate roof can last over 100 years. It’s fireproof and impervious to water, making it a true generational investment, though it is the most expensive option and requires a specialized installation.
  • Rubber Roofing (EPDM/TPO): The best solution for flat or low-slope roofs on additions or porches. It’s a durable, waterproof membrane that prevents pooling water issues.

Here’s how they stack up:

Material Lifespan (Years) Average Cost (Initial) MA Weather Resistance
Asphalt Shingles 20-30 Moderate Good (high-quality needed for wind/snow)
Metal Roofing 40-70+ High Excellent (sheds snow/ice, wind-resistant, durable)
Slate Roofing 75-150+ Very High Superior (impervious to water, fireproof, long-lasting)
Rubber Roofing 20-30 Moderate Excellent for low-slope/flat roofs (waterproof, flexible)

Key 3: Budgeting for Your Roofing Kingston MA Project

Understanding costs helps you make smart decisions. For roofing repairs in Kingston, expect to spend between $380 and $1,800, with an average of $1,100. Minor fixes are on the lower end, while more significant damage can cost more. Catching problems early is the best way to save money.

A full roof replacement in Kingston typically costs between $5,890 and $12,800. Larger homes or those with steep, complex rooflines and premium materials can cost more.

Several factors influence the final price:

  • Roof Size and Pitch: Larger and steeper roofs require more materials and labor.
  • Material Choice: Asphalt is the most budget-friendly, while metal and slate have a higher upfront cost.
  • Underlying Damage: Rotted decking found after tear-off will add to the project cost.
  • Labor: This typically accounts for about 60% of the total cost. Hiring skilled professionals is essential to protect your investment, as low bids often mean cut corners.

Key 4: How to Choose a Reputable Roofing Contractor in Kingston MA

Choosing the right contractor is the most critical part of your Roofing Kingston MA project. With 44 local roofers, it’s important to ask the right questions to find a true professional.

  • License and Insurance: Insist on seeing proof of a current Massachusetts license, liability insurance, and worker’s compensation. This is non-negotiable for your protection.
  • Warranties: Ask about both the manufacturer’s warranty (for materials) and the contractor’s workmanship warranty (for installation quality). Get both in writing.
  • Certifications: Look for a GAF Master Elite certification. Only 2% of roofers earn this, and it allows them to offer superior warranties. It’s a mark of quality and training.
  • Local References: A reputable contractor will gladly provide references from recent projects in the Kingston area.
  • Tear-Off Process: Confirm they will perform a full tear-off of the old roof. This allows for inspection of the roof deck and ensures a proper installation.
  • Cleanup Procedures: Professional crews should leave your property spotless, using magnetic sweepers to pick up all nails and debris.

Key 5: Understanding Warranties and Local Regulations

Paperwork isn’t exciting, but it’s critical for protecting your Roofing Kingston MA investment. You need to understand two key areas.

Warranties:

  • Manufacturer Warranty: Covers the roofing materials (shingles, underlayment) against defects. Top brands like GAF offer long-term coverage, especially when installed by certified contractors.
  • Workmanship Warranty: Covers the quality of the installation itself. This is crucial, as improper installation is a common cause of roof failure. A strong workmanship warranty shows the contractor stands behind their work.

Local Regulations:

  • Building Permits: Most roof replacements in Kingston require a building permit from the town. Your contractor should handle this process to ensure your project is legal and compliant.
  • Building Code: All work must adhere to the Massachusetts State Building Code. This ensures your roof is safe, structurally sound, and properly installed. Non-compliance can lead to fines, voided insurance, and problems when you sell your home.

Key 6: The Benefits of Regular Roof Inspections

A professional roof inspection is preventive medicine for your home. We recommend an annual inspection, especially after major storms, to:

  • Extend Your Roof’s Life: Catching small issues like a loose shingle or clogged gutter early can add years to your roof’s lifespan.
  • Save Money: An inspection can identify hidden leaks, compromised flashing, and granule loss before they turn into thousands of dollars in water damage.
  • Protect Your Warranty: Some manufacturer warranties require periodic inspections to remain valid.

Key 7: Preparing Your Home for a Roofing Project

A little preparation ensures your installation day goes smoothly:

  • Clear the Area: Move vehicles from the driveway and clear a path around your home for our crew, equipment, and dumpster.
  • Protect Outdoor Items: Move patio furniture, grills, and planters away from the house. We will use tarps to protect delicate landscaping.
  • Secure Indoor Items: Vibrations can cause items on walls or shelves to shift. Consider securing fragile items, especially on the top floor.
  • Plan for Pets and Children: Keep pets and children safely indoors and away from the construction zone.
  • Notify Neighbors: A quick heads-up about the noise is a considerate gesture.
